Self-Contained Resource Program Teacher
The Self-Contained Resource Program is a cross categorical classroom designation where the teacher is responsible for providing specialized instruction and support to students with disabilities in accordance with their Individualized Education Programs (IEPs). The teacher will create and maintain a safe, structured, and inclusive learning environment that supports students' academic, behavioral, social-emotional, and functional growth while collaborating with staff, families, and service providers.
